Gardai in Donegal have reported multiple instances of extreme speeding during the Bank Holiday weekend, including a driver clocked at 159km/h. Authorities emphasize that speeding is a primary factor in fatal road collisions and continue to enforce strict speed limits.

A motorist in Donegal was clocked driving at 159km/h on Bank Holiday Monday.
